Pretty in Pink

In an effort to appeal to more women, Molson Coors is launching pink beer in the United Kingdom.

July 27, 2011

LONDON - Following brand research that revealed 79 percent of women avoid drinking beer out of a fear of bloating, Molson Coors has announced plans to launch in early fall a pink beer in England, specifically targeting women who currently shy away from drinking beer, the Winnipeg Free Press reports.

The 4 percent alcohol pink brew, dubbed Animée, will be available in clear filtered, crisp rosé, and zesty lemon varieties, a fresh and light lineup that Molson Coors hopes will attract female consumers. Molson Coors?? announcement comes after Danish brewer Carlsberg recently rolled out a beer in a sleek bottled called Copenhagen, targeting women.

"Women are an essential part of future growth for the beer industry and can no longer be ignored. We need to repair the reputation of beer among women by launching products that meet their needs," said Kristy McCready, communications partner at Molson Coors.

No word yet on whether Molson Coors will distribute the beer in the United States.
